RESUMO

BACKGROUND: The present study aimed to quantify the burden of structural heart disease in Nepali children. METHODS: We performed a school-based cross-sectional echocardiographic screening study with cluster random sampling among children 5-16 years of age. RESULTS: Between December 2012 and January 2019, 6573 children (mean age 10.6 ± 2.9 years) from 41 randomly selected schools underwent echocardiographic screening. Structural heart disease was detected in 14.0 per 1000 children (95% CI 11.3-17.1) and was congenital in 3.3 per 1000 (95% CI 2.1-5.1) and rheumatic in 10.6 per 1000 (95% CI 8.3-13.4). Rates of rheumatic heart disease were higher among children attending public as compared to private schools (OR 2.8, 95% CI 1.6-5.2, p = 0.0001). CONCLUSION: Rheumatic heart disease accounted for three out of four cases of structural heart disease and was more common among children attending public as compared to private schools.

RESUMO

INTRODUCTION: Systematic echocardiographic screening of children in regions with an endemic pattern of rheumatic heart disease allows for the early detection of valvular lesions suggestive of subclinical rheumatic heart disease. The natural course of latent rheumatic heart disease is, however, incompletely understood at this time. METHODS: We performed a prospective cohort study of children detected to have echocardiographic evidence of definite or borderline rheumatic heart disease according to the World Heart Federation Criteria. RESULTS: Among 53 children found to have definite (36) or borderline (17) rheumatic heart disease, 44 (83%) children underwent follow-up at a median of 1.9 years (IQR 1.1-4.5). The median age of the children was 11 years (IQR 9-14) and 34 (64.2%) were girls. Among children with definite rheumatic heart disease, 21 (58.3%) were adherent to secondary antibiotic prophylaxis, 7 (19.4%) were not, information on adherence was missing in 2 (5.6%) children and 6 (16.7%) were lost to follow-up. Regression of disease was observed in 10 children (27.8%), whereas 20 children (55.6%) had stable disease. Among children adherent to secondary prophylaxis, seven (33.3%) showed regression of disease. Among children with borderline disease, seven (41.2%) showed regression of disease, three (17.6%) progression of disease, four (23.5%) remained stable and three (17.6%) were lost to follow-up. On univariate analysis, we identified no predictors of disease regression, and no predictors for lost to follow-up or non-adherence with secondary antibiotic prophylaxis. CONCLUSION: Definite rheumatic heart disease showed regression in one in four children. Borderline disease was spontaneously reversible in less than half of the children and progressed to definite rheumatic heart disease in one in five children. TRIAL REGISTRATION NUMBER: NCT01550068.

RESUMO

Importance: Echocardiographic screening allows for early detection of subclinical stages of rheumatic heart disease among children in endemic regions. Objective: To investigate the effectiveness of systematic echocardiographic screening in combination with secondary antibiotic prophylaxis on the prevalence of rheumatic heart disease. Design, Setting, and Participants: This cluster randomized clinical trial included students 9 to 16 years of age attending public and private schools in urban and rural areas of the Sunsari district in Nepal that had been randomly selected on November 17, 2012. Echocardiographic follow-up was performed between January 7, 2016, and January 3, 2019. Interventions: In the experimental group, children underwent systematic echocardiographic screening followed by secondary antibiotic prophylaxis in case they had echocardiographic evidence of latent rheumatic heart disease. In the control group, children underwent no echocardiographic screening. Main Outcomes and Measures: Prevalence of the composite of definite or borderline rheumatic heart disease according to the World Heart Federation criteria in experimental and control schools as assessed 4 years after intervention. Results: A total of 35 schools were randomized to the experimental group (n = 19) or the control group (n = 16). After a median of 4.3 years (interquartile range [IQR], 4.0-4.5 years), 17 of 19 schools in the experimental group (2648 children; median age at follow-up, 12.1 years; IQR, 10.3-12.5 years; 1308 [49.4%] male) and 15 of 16 schools in the control group (1325 children; median age at follow-up, 10.6 years; IQR, 10.0-12.5 years; 682 [51.5%] male) underwent echocardiographic follow-up. The prevalence of definite or borderline rheumatic heart disease was 10.8 per 1000 children (95% CI, 4.7-24.7) in the control group and 3.8 per 1000 children (95% CI, 1.5-9.8) in the experimental group (odds ratio, 0.34; 95% CI, 0.11-1.07; P = .06). The prevalence in the experimental group at baseline had been 12.9 per 1000 children (95% CI, 9.2-18.1). In the experimental group, the odds ratio of definite or borderline rheumatic heart disease at follow-up vs baseline was 0.29 (95% CI, 0.13-0.65; P = .008). Conclusions and Relevance: School-based echocardiographic screening in combination with secondary antibiotic prophylaxis in children with evidence of latent rheumatic heart disease may be an effective strategy to reduce the prevalence of definite or borderline rheumatic heart disease in endemic regions. RESUMO

In the present study, midazolam (MDZ)-loaded chitosan nanoparticle formulation was investigated for enhanced transport to the brain through the intranasal (IN) route. These days, IN MDZ is very much in demand for treating life-threatening seizure emergencies; therefore, its nanoparticle formulation was formulated in the present work because it could substantially improve its brain targeting via the IN route. MDZ-loaded chitosan nanoparticles (MDZ-CSNPs) were formulated and optimized by the ionic gelation method and then evaluated for particle size, particle size distribution (PDI), drug loading (DL), encapsulation efficiency (EE), and in vitro release as well as in vitro permeation. The concentration of MDZ in the brain after the intranasal administration of MDZ-CSNPs (Cmax 423.41 ± 10.23 ng/mL, tmax 2 h, and area under the curve from 0 to 480 min (AUC0-480) of 1920.87 ng.min/mL) was found to be comparatively higher to that achieved following intravenous (IV) administration of MDZ solution (Cmax 245.44 ± 12.83 ng/mL, tmax 1 h, and AUC0-480 1208.94 ng.min/mL) and IN administration of MDZ solution (Cmax 211.67 ± 12.82, tmax 2 h, and AUC0-480 1036.78 ng.min/mL). The brain-blood ratio of MDZ-CSNPs (IN) were significantly greater at all sampling time points when compared to that of MDZ solution (IV) and MDZ (IN), which indicate that direct nose-to-brain delivery by bypassing the blood-brain barrier demonstrates superiority in brain delivery. The drug-targeting efficiency (DTE%) as well as nose-to-brain direct transport percentage (DTP%) of MDZ-CSNPs (IN) was found to be comparatively higher than that for other formulations, suggesting better brain targeting potential. Thus, the obtained results demonstrated that IN MDZ-CSNP has come up as a promising approach, which exhibits tremendous potential to mark a new landscape for the treatment of status epilepticus.

RESUMO

IMPORTANCE: Although rheumatic heart disease has been nearly eradicated in high-income countries, 3 in 4 children grow up in parts of the world where it is still endemic. OBJECTIVES: To determine the prevalence of clinically silent and manifest rheumatic heart disease as a function of age, sex, and socioeconomic status and to estimate age-specific incidence. DESIGN, SETTING, AND PARTICIPANTS: In this school-based cross-sectional study with cluster sampling, 26 schools in the Sunsari district in Eastern Nepal with 5467 eligible children 5 to 15 years of age were randomly selected from 595 registered schools. After exclusion of 289 children, 5178 children were enrolled in the present study from December 12, 2012, through September 12, 2014. Data analysis was performed from October 1, 2014, to April 15, 2015. EXPOSURES: Demographic and socioeconomic characteristics were acquired in a standardized interview by means of a questionnaire customized to the age of the children. A focused medical history was followed by a brief physical examination. Cardiac auscultation and transthoracic echocardiography were performed by 2 independent physicians. MAIN OUTCOMES AND MEASURES: Rheumatic heart disease according to the World Heart Federation criteria. RESULTS: The median age of the 5178 children enrolled in the study was 10 years (interquartile range, 8-13 years), and 2503 (48.3%) were female. The prevalence of borderline or definite rheumatic heart disease was 10.2 (95% CI, 7.5-13.0) per 1000 children and increased with advancing age from 5.5 (95% CI, 3.5-7.5) per 1000 children 5 years of age to 16.0 (95% CI, 14.9-17.0) in children 15 years of age, whereas the mean incidence remained stable at 1.1 per 1000 children per year. Children with rheumatic heart disease were older than children without rheumatic heart disease (median age [interquartile range], 11 [9-14] years vs 10 [8-13] years; P = .03), more commonly female (34 [64.2%] vs 2469 [48.2%]; P = .02), and more frequently went to governmental schools (40 [75.5%] vs 2792 [54.5%]; P = .002). Silent disease (n = 44) was 5 times more common than manifest disease (n = 9). CONCLUSIONS AND RELEVANCE: Rheumatic heart disease affects 1 in 100 schoolchildren in Eastern Nepal, is primarily clinically silent, and may be more common among girls. The overall prevalence and the ratio of manifest to subclinical disease increase with advancing age, whereas the incidence remains stable at 1.1 per 1000 children per year. Early detection of silent disease may help prevent progression to severe valvular damage.

RESUMO

BACKGROUND: Rheumatic heart disease accounts for up to 250 000 premature deaths every year worldwide and can be regarded as a physical manifestation of poverty and social inequality. We aimed to estimate the prevalence of rheumatic heart disease in endemic countries as assessed by different screening modalities and as a function of age. METHODS: We searched Medline, Embase, the Latin American and Caribbean System on Health Sciences Information, African Journals Online, and the Cochrane Database of Systematic Reviews for population-based studies published between Jan 1, 1993, and June 30, 2014, that reported on prevalence of rheumatic heart disease among children and adolescents (≥ 5 years to <18 years). We assessed prevalence of clinically silent and clinically manifest rheumatic heart disease in random effects meta-analyses according to screening modality and geographical region. We assessed the association between social inequality and rheumatic heart disease with the Gini coefficient. We used Poisson regression to analyse the effect of age on prevalence of rheumatic heart disease and estimated the incidence of rheumatic heart disease from prevalence data. FINDINGS: We included 37 populations in the systematic review and meta-analysis. The pooled prevalence of rheumatic heart disease detected by cardiac auscultation was 2·9 per 1000 people (95% CI 1·7-5·0) and by echocardiography it was 12·9 per 1000 people (8·9-18·6), with substantial heterogeneity between individual reports for both screening modalities (I² = 99·0% and 94·9%, respectively). We noted an association between social inequality expressed by the Gini coefficient and prevalence of rheumatic heart disease (p = 0·0002). The prevalence of clinically silent rheumatic heart disease (21·1 per 1000 people, 95% CI 14·1-31·4) was about seven to eight times higher than that of clinically manifest disease (2·7 per 1000 people, 1·6-4·4). Prevalence progressively increased with advancing age, from 4·7 per 1000 people (95% CI 0·0-11·2) at age 5 years to 21·0 per 1000 people (6·8-35·1) at 16 years. The estimated incidence was 1·6 per 1000 people (0·8-2·3) and remained constant across age categories (range 2·5, 95% CI 1·3-3·7 in 5-year-old children to 1·7, 0·0-5·1 in 15-year-old adolescents). We noted no sex-related differences in prevalence (p = 0·829).

RESUMO

OBJECTIVE: To investigate the prevalence, characteristics and maternal and perinatal outcomes of pregnancies complicated by heart disease. DESIGN: Prospective single-centre registry. SETTING: Tertiary care teaching hospital in eastern Nepal. PATIENTS: Pregnant women presenting to the antenatal clinic and/or labour room between 1 March 2012 and 31 March 2013. MAIN OUTCOME MEASURES: Prevalence, characteristics, and maternal and perinatal outcomes of pregnancies complicated by heart disease. RESULTS: Fifty-three out of 9463 pregnancies (0.6%) were complicated by cardiac disease. Proportions of acquired, congenital and arrhythmic heart disease amounted to 89%, 9% and 2%, respectively. Rheumatic heart disease (RHD) was the most frequent cardiac disease complicating pregnancy (n=47). Among 45 women with RHD continuing pregnancy until delivery, 30 (67%) were primigravidae. The predominant valvular pathology was mitral stenosis (62%), followed by mitral regurgitation (21%) and aortic regurgitation (13%). Twenty women (44%) underwent elective or emergency caesarean section. Maternal and fetal/perinatal mortality of pregnancies complicated by RHD amounted to 4% and 16%, respectively. New York Heart Association (NYHA) functional class III or class IV (HR 6.0, 95% CI 1.2 to 29.1, p=0.026), pulmonary hypertension (HR 9.1, 95% CI 1.6 to 51.5, p=0.012) and severe mitral stenosis (HR 7.0, 95% CI 1.4 to 34.4, p=0.017) were identified as predictors of maternal or fetal/perinatal mortality in an univariate analysis. CONCLUSIONS: Rheumatic mitral stenosis was the most frequent heart disease complicating pregnancy in a consecutive cohort from a teaching hospital in Nepal. Exercise intolerance, pulmonary hypertension and severe mitral stenosis were identified as predictors of maternal or fetal/perinatal mortality.

RESUMO

We present the case of an atypical presentation of myelofibrosis presenting with acute inferior-wall ST-elevation myocardial infarction. Besides cigarette smoking, the patient had no known traditional cardiovascular risk factors like diabetes, hypertension, or a sedentary lifestyle. He, however, had a hypercoagulable state due to a myeloproliferative neoplasm. This demonstrates that the typical presentation of a common emergency condition may involve more complex underlying illness, which when identified, may change the approach to the management of the patient for a more optimal outcome.

RESUMO

OBJECTIVES: To evaluate a protocol for a population-based programme targeting the prevention of rheumatic heart disease (RHD) progression by early echocardiographic diagnosis of valvular lesions and timely implementation of secondary prevention. DESIGN: Observational survey with a subsequent prospective cohort study. SETTING: Private boarding school in the urban area of the Sunsari district situated on the foothills of the Lower Himalayan Range in Eastern Nepal. PARTICIPANTS: Fifty-four unselected school-going children 5-15 years of age, 24 girls and 30 boys. PRIMARY OUTCOME MEASURE: Logistic feasibility of a large-scale population-based screening study using the echocardiographic criteria formulated by the World Heart Federation, with longitudinal follow-up of children with definite or borderline RHD in a prospective cohort study. RESULTS: Standardised interview, physical examination and screening echocardiography were performed in a three-staged process and took approximately 6 min per child. Socio-economic status was assessed using surrogate markers such as the occupation of the primary caregiver, numbers of rooms at home, car, television, cell phone and internet connection. Physical examination was focused on cardiac auscultation and signs of acute rheumatic fever and targeted echocardiography was performed by an independent examiner without knowledge of the clinical findings. Two children with evidence of borderline RHD were re-examined at B.P. Koirala Institute of Health Sciences and the indication for secondary antibiotic prevention was discussed with the parents and the children. At 6 months of follow-up, echocardiographic findings were stable in both children. Implementation of secondary antibiotic prevention was challenged by impaired awareness of subclinical RHD among parents and inadequate cooperation with family physicians. CONCLUSIONS: This pilot study shows that the methods outlined in the protocol can be translated into a large-scale population-based study. We learned that education and collaboration with teachers, parents and family physicians/paediatricians will be of key importance in order to establish a sustainable programme.

RESUMO

BACKGROUND: The burden of rheumatic heart disease (RHD) continues to be a major contributor to morbidity and premature death in poor and developing countries. We investigated patterns of valvular involvement in patients with RHD as observed in a large tertiary care hospital in eastern Nepal. METHODS: We retrospectively reviewed transthoracic echocardiography reports from patients diagnosed with RHD between June 1999 and February 2011. RESULTS: Among 10 860 transthoracic echocardiography studies, 1055 female and 658 male patients were diagnosed with RHD, 25.7% of the patients being below 20 years of age. Mitral regurgitation was the most common valvular lesion across all age groups irrespective of sex (n = 1321, 77.1%). Female patients were significantly older as compared to male patients at the time of presentation (32.8 ±â€Š15.2 versus 28.5 ±â€Š15.4 years; P < 0.001) and more commonly presented with mitral stenosis as compared to male patients (62.8 versus 51.5%; P < 0.001), with a peak between the age of 30 and 49 years. Conversely, aortic regurgitation was more common in men as compared to women (55.6 versus 48.9%; P = 0.007). Involvement of both the mitral and the aortic valve was observed in 49.8% of the patients and was more common in men as compared to women (52.7 versus 47.8%; P = 0.047). CONCLUSION: In this consecutive cohort of patients with RHD in Nepal differential patterns of valvular involvement are observed across sex and age categories.

RESUMO

INTRODUCTION: Rheumatic heart disease (RHD) remains a major contributor to morbidity and mortality in developing countries. The reported prevalence rates of RHD are highly variable and mainly attributable to differences in the sensitivity of either clinical screening to detect advanced heart disease or echocardiographic evaluation where disease is diagnosed earlier across a continuous spectrum. The clinical significance of diagnosis of subclinical RHD by echocardiographic screening and early implementation of secondary prevention has not been clearly established. METHODS AND ANALYSIS: The authors designed a cross-sectional survey to determine the prevalence of RHD in children from private and public schools between the age of 5 and 15 years in urban and rural areas of Eastern Nepal using both cardiac auscultation and echocardiographic evaluation. Children with RHD will be treated with secondary prevention and enrolled in a prospective cohort study. The authors will compare the prevalence rates by cardiac auscultation and echocardiography, determine risk factors associated with diagnosis and progression of RHD, investigate social and economic barriers for receiving adequate cardiac care and assess clinical outcomes with regular medical surveillance as a function of stage of disease at the time of diagnosis. Prospective clinical studies investigating the impact of secondary prevention for subclinical RHD on long-term clinical outcome will be of central relevance for future health resource utilisation in developing countries. RESUMO

Background. This study was carried out to establish the prevalence of cardiovascular risks such as hypertension, obesity, and diabetes in Eastern Nepal. This study also establishes the prevalence of metabolic syndrome (MS) and its relationships to these cardiovascular risk factors and lifestyle. Methods. 14,425 subjects aged 20-100 (mean 41.4 ± 15.1) were screened with a physical examination and blood tests. Both the International Diabetic Federation (IDF) and National Cholesterol Education Programme's (NCEP) definitions for MS were used and compared. Results. 34% of the participants had hypertension, and 6.3% were diabetic. 28% were overweight, and 32% were obese. 22.5% of the participants had metabolic syndrome based on IDF criteria and 20.7% according to the NCEP definition. Prevalence was higher in the less educated, people working at home, and females. There was no significant correlation between the participants' lifestyle factors and the prevalence of MS. Conclusion. The high incidence of dyslipidemia and abdominal obesity could be the major contributors to MS in Nepal. Education also appears to be related to the prevalence of MS. This study confirms the need to initiate appropriate treatment options for a condition which is highly prevalent in Eastern Nepal.
